Output 84b3745dd9d37caf26f8aebf6324c5a441ca4d2f6a71b2256219def42e89c33f:149

value
348800
script pubkey
OP_0 OP_PUSHBYTES_32 715a1e668d7ae78242e73ee2c6248767c158e895e2700d9b3418c870e4244cc5
address
bc1qw9dpue5d0tncysh88m3vvfy8vlq436y4ufcqmxe5rry8pepyfnzsnf05f3
transaction
84b3745dd9d37caf26f8aebf6324c5a441ca4d2f6a71b2256219def42e89c33f
spent
true